## Changelog — Ticktrace 1.9

### Renamed: DRIFT_API_TOKEN
During the cron drift investigation we found plugins confusing this variable with the metrics token, so it has been renamed to indicate it authorizes drift-report uploads specifically. Plugin authors must read the new name from 1.9 onward; the old name is ignored without warning. Sample env files in the SDK are updated. In your deployment env file, the drift-report upload secret is set on the next line.

env line for fawef-taguf: VAULT_KEY13=a9695905a9a90

Subject: Quickstore 4.2 — bloom filter now fronts the KV layer

Plugin authors: starting with this release, Quickstore places a bloom filter ahead of the key-value store. Negative lookups return faster; false positives fall through safely. No API changes are required on your side. Verify your plugin against the staging build referenced below.

session token of fahif-tadup = htk3_9c7

Rollout procedure (Lanternly flag framework): create the flag in the Pryce console, set targeting to the internal cohort first, and watch error dashboards for fifteen minutes before widening. Never edit a flag directly in the datastore — the framework caches aggressively and you will cause drift. When filing your rollout record, include the token below.

pipeline stamp: htk31_f769b577b3028a4e9958e5bb8d1259a